cubicweb/devtools/test/unittest_devctl.py
branch3.26
changeset 12688 8da08cc8640f
parent 12071 fb0b74fecc4d
child 12709 280c9db41038
equal deleted inserted replaced
12687:59c3e639f62c 12688:8da08cc8640f
    25 
    25 
    26 from cubicweb.devtools.testlib import TemporaryDirectory
    26 from cubicweb.devtools.testlib import TemporaryDirectory
    27 
    27 
    28 
    28 
    29 def newcube(directory, name):
    29 def newcube(directory, name):
    30     cmd = ['cubicweb-ctl', 'newcube', '--directory', directory, name]
    30     cmd = ['cubicweb-ctl', 'newcube', '--directory', directory,
       
    31            '--short-description', 'short_desc', name]
    31     proc = Popen(cmd, stdin=PIPE, stdout=PIPE, stderr=STDOUT)
    32     proc = Popen(cmd, stdin=PIPE, stdout=PIPE, stderr=STDOUT)
    32     stdout, _ = proc.communicate(b'short_desc\n')
    33     returncode = proc.wait()
    33     return proc.returncode, stdout
    34     return returncode, proc.stdout.read()
    34 
    35 
    35 
    36 
    36 def to_unicode(msg):
    37 def to_unicode(msg):
    37     return msg.decode(sys.getdefaultencoding(), errors='replace')
    38     return msg.decode(sys.getdefaultencoding(), errors='replace')
    38 
    39